Directions

  1. Preheat o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C).
  2. Into food processor, put sweet potatoes, evaporated milk, sugar, salt, cinnamon, nutmeg, rum, eggs and butter or margarine. Blend until smooth. Pour into pie shell.
  3. Bake for 10 minutes in preheated oven. Reduce heat to 300 degrees F (150 degrees C). Bake for about 50 minutes more, or until the filling is firm.
